Charles Fernando Corrêa (born 9 October 1992) is a Brazilian slalom canoeist who has competed since 2010.

Together with Anderson Oliveira he won a silver medal at the 2015 Pan American Games and placed 11th in the slalom doubles (C2) event at the 2016 Summer Olympics in Rio de Janeiro.
